Job Description

Walt Disney Imagineering (WDI) is the master planning, creative development, design, engineering, production, project management, and research and development arm of the Disney Experiences business segment. Representing more than 150 disciplines, its talented teams of Imagineers are responsible for the creation of Disney resorts, theme parks and attractions, hotels, water parks, real estate developments, regional entertainment venues, cruise ships, and new media technology projects worldwide including Disney Intellectual Properties such as Marvel, Pixar, and Lucasfilm.

About the Role & Team

The Sr. Manager - Show Control Hardware Engineering reports to the Executive Show Systems and leads a global team of Show Control Hardware Engineers and Designers. This role is responsible for designing, creating, implementing, and managing all aspects of the physical and digital systems behind immersive and innovative guest show experiences. This includes integrating various technologies such as Audio-Animatronics, show action equipment, and complex sensors and robotics.

Required Qualifications & Skills

  • Ten years of experience in engineering within high-tech environments, industrial automation, robotics, or themed entertainment.
  • Five years managing multidisciplinary engineering teams.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of industrial control systems and robotics.
  • Experience in leading high-budget capital projects.
  • Proficiency in project management skills like resource loading, schedule development, budgeting, and risk management.
  • Experience in managing technical documents such as Requirements Specifications and Acceptance Test Procedures.
  • Proven ability to manage vendors and engineering consultants effectively to achieve goals.
  • Knowledge in automation and real-time control software systems.
  • Expertise in digital motion control technologies, safety systems, and electronic design.
  • Familiarity with communication protocols like Ethernet, TCP/IP, serial, and fieldbuses including EtherCAT and CANopen.
  • Electrical design standards and codes, including UL508a, NEC, and ASTM.
  • Ability to guide and inspire teams.
  • Attention to detail and commitment to safety standards.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ience in embedded software development in C, C++, and other systems programming languages, with a focus on hard-real-time control concepts.
  • Proficiency with Beckhoff Automation products, architectures, and software development for TwinCAT and TwinSAFE.
  • Familiarity with digital motion controllers and servo drives including Elmo, Maxon, and Copley.
  • Expertise in engineering design tools such as AutoCAD, MatLab, Simulink, and Solidworks.
  • Knowledge in theatrical automation and digital computer control elements.
  • Experience with digital show control platforms and technologies such as Alcorn McBride, Medialon, AMX, and TAIT Navigator.
